A tripartite agreement among the Philippines, China and Vietnam allows joint seismic exploration of the Spratly Islands, subject of a long territorial dispute. Objections include possible violation of Constitutional ban against natural resources exploration by foreigners. Lots of uproar. Both Senate and Lower House want probes.
